There are six entrances to the Great Smoky Mountains National Park. Besides the two main entrances at Gatlinburg, TN and Cherokee, NC, there's an entrance at Townsend, TN and three lesser-known entrances at Cosby, Cataloochee, and Wears Valley. A quick guide hike and drive, according to time you have in hand for the national park one hour Hike to cataract falls behind the sugarland visitor centre, Dirve to Maloney point / Carlos campbell overlook 2-3 hours Hike to Laurel Falls; Drive to Newfound gap; Walk along the Appalanch trail 4-5 hours Hike to Alum cave trail or Chimney tops trails; Drive to Cades cove loop road & look for wildlife 1-3 days Hike to Abram falls along cade cove loop road and Mt. Leconte via Alum Cave Bluffs trail; Drive through the foothills Parkwayfor Scenic vistas more than 4 days Hike Other popular trails like Ramsey cascade / CHarlies Bunion; Drive to Cades cove, Newfound gap, Roaring fork Motor Nature Trail, Ocunaluftee and look for wildlife. Long Hiking guide: Appalachain Trail: 4.0 miles one way to Charlies Bunion, Elevation change of 1,600 feet Chimney Tops Trail: 4 miles roundtrip, Elevation change of 1,400 feet.
